Price: $9.99 @ Trader Joe’s
What They Said:
Per the bottle “Violets, medjool dates, anise and plum.” Guess they thought that was enough said…
What I Think:
(14.5%) 24% Grenache, 55% Syrah, 21% Mourvedre – Ripe but backed by acidity with some jammy fruit around the edges that lingers with spice all the way through to an earthy, lasting finish. Warm, smooth, a touch rich, spiced and lasting. A nice effort here and if this wine had a proper face I’d be inclined to buy it again. But at $10 these mystery labels are losing their allure for me…
Wine Geek Notes: This one tracks to Vine Intervention LLC which is owned by Marc Cummings who also happens to be the winemaker at Kelsey See Canyon Vineyards and has his own label at Drake Vineyards
Rating: Good but… (as mentioned I’d prefer putting a face to this name)
